Weighted training pucks are a valuable tool for hockey players looking to enhance their skills and performance on the ice. Here are some key benefits:
Using weighted pucks helps players develop upper body strength and stick handling power. The added weight forces players to exert more effort, leading to stronger shots and better puck control.
Weighted pucks improve hand-eye coordination and fine motor skills. Players learn to handle the puck with precision, making them more effective in game situations.
Practicing with heavier pucks allows players to refine their shooting techniques. They can develop muscle memory for their shooting form, which translates to better accuracy and power during games.
Regularly training with weighted pucks conditions players' muscles, enhancing their endurance on the ice. This is crucial during long games or high-intensity matches.
Weighted pucks can be used in various training drills, making them a versatile addition to any practice session. Whether for shooting, passing, or stick handling, they adapt to different training needs.

Weighted training pucks are an excellent tool for enhancing skills in hockey, but there are several factors to consider to ensure proper use and effectiveness.
When selecting weighted pucks, consider the player's age and skill level. Younger players or beginners may benefit from lighter pucks, while experienced players can handle heavier options to build strength.
Define specific training goals. If the objective is to improve stickhandling speed, lighter pucks might be more beneficial, whereas heavier pucks are suitable for strength training and improving shooting power.
Limit the duration of using weighted pucks in training sessions. Overuse can lead to fatigue and poor technique. Incorporate them into drills for short periods to maintain skill integrity.
Consider the surface on which you are training. Weighted pucks perform differently on ice versus synthetic surfaces. Ensure that the chosen puck is suitable for the training environment to prevent damage to equipment and maximize effectiveness.
Be mindful of the risk of injury. Using weighted pucks incorrectly can lead to strains, especially if a player is not accustomed to added weight. Gradually increase weight and pay attention to any discomfort.
By considering these factors, players can effectively integrate weighted training pucks into their routine, enhancing their performance and skill development.
Weighted training pucks are a popular tool for hockey training. They're designed to help players improve their shooting strength and puck handling skills. But are they suitable for beginners?
Weighted pucks generally weigh more than standard pucks. This added weight can help develop muscle strength and improve shooting power over time. However, for beginners, there are several factors to consider.
For beginners, it’s best to start with standard pucks to develop basic skills and proper technique. Once they are comfortable and confident, introducing weighted pucks in moderation can be beneficial. Engaging with a coach or a more experienced player can provide guidance on when to incorporate weighted training pucks effectively.
In conclusion, while weighted training pucks can be beneficial in the right context, beginners should prioritize mastering basic skills first for long-term improvement.
Weighted training pucks are a fantastic tool to enhance your hockey skills and build strength. Here’s how you can effectively incorporate them into your practice routine.
Begin by using weighted pucks during simple stickhandling drills. This builds strength in your wrists and arms, improving your overall stickhandling ability.
Incorporate weighted pucks into your shooting drills. Practice slap shots, wrist shots, and snap shots. The extra weight helps develop more powerful shooting mechanics.
Use the weighted pucks for passing drills with a teammate or against a wall. This improves your passing accuracy and strengthens your core and lower body while you stabilize your body during passes.
Practice with weighted pucks in game-like scenarios. For instance, simulate power plays or quick transitions to adapt your skills under pressure with the extra challenge.
Once you feel comfortable with weighted pucks, gradually transition back to standard pucks. You’ll notice increased speed and control, enhancing your on-ice performance.
